P.C.:
1) Heard the learned counsel for the applicant and the learned APP. 2) This is an application for suspension of sentence and releasing the applicant on bail.
3) The applicant is convicted under Section 8 and 12 of the Protection of Children from Sexual Offences Act, 2012 (POCSO Act) and Section 354 and 506 of the Indian Penal Code and sentenced to suffer rigorous imprisonment for 4 years under the provisions of POCSO Act and 2 years of rigorous imprisonment under the provisions of Indian Penal Code respectively and to pay a total fine of Rs.18,000/-by the Judgment and Order dated 27.4.2016 passed by the Designated Judge under the POCSO Act, Greater Mumbai in POCSO Special Case No.617 of 2013. The learned
Dond 1/2 appa.636-2016.sxw counsel for the applicant submitted that applicant was on bail during pendency of the trial and there is no report of breach of any conditions imposed upon him.
4) The maximum substantive sentence imposed upon the appliant is 4 years of rigorous imprisonment. Since sentence imposed upon the applicant is a short term sentence and the applicant was on bail during the pendency of trial, I am inclined to release the applicant on bail. 5) Hence, the following Order:
(i) The applicant be released on bail on his furnishing PR bond of Rs.25,000/- with one or two solvent local sureties in the like amount.
(ii) Before his release from jail, the applicant shall deposit the entire fine amount in the Trial Court.
(iii) After his release from jail, the applicant shall attend the Trial Court once in three months on every 1st Monday during 11.00 to 1.00 p.m.
(iv) Application is allowed in the aforesaid terms. (A.S. GADKARI, J.)
